Step 1: Define Your Game

Before you start building your game, you need to have a clear understanding of what you want to create. This includes the game’s concept, rules, and objectives. Defining your game’s mechanics and features will help you determine what you need to build and what technologies you’ll need to use. Once you have a clear vision for your game, you can move on to the next step.

Step 2: Plan Your User Interface

The user interface (UI) of your game is what the player interacts with, and it’s essential that it’s easy to use and visually appealing. You’ll need to plan the layout of your game, including menus, buttons, and screens. To create a responsive and user-friendly UI, you’ll need to consider the devices that your game will be played on, such as desktops, tablets, and smartphones. It’s essential to test your UI on multiple devices to ensure that it’s accessible and easy to navigate.

Step 3: Set Up Your Environment

To start building your game, you’ll need to set up your development environment. You’ll need a code editor, such as Visual Studio Code, and a package manager, such as npm or yarn, to install and manage dependencies. You’ll also need to install Node.js, a JavaScript runtime that allows you to run JavaScript on the server.

Step 4: Create Your Components

React is a component-based library, which means that you’ll need to create components for every part of your game’s UI. Components are reusable and can be easily composed to create complex UIs. You’ll need to create components for menus, buttons, screens, and any other elements of your game’s UI.

Step 5: Manage State with Redux

Managing the state is a critical part of building any gaming app. The state is the data that determines how your game behaves, such as the player’s score, the game’s level, or the state of the game world. Redux is a state management library that can help you manage your game’s state. It allows you to centralize your game’s state and makes it easy to share data between components.

Step 6: Add Animations and Interactions

Games are all about animations and interactions, and React provides several tools to help you create dynamic and engaging UIs. You can use CSS animations, React animations, or third-party libraries like GreenSock to add animations to your game. You can also use React’s event system to handle user interactions, such as clicks and keyboard inputs.

Step 7: Test Your Game

Testing your game is essential to ensure that it’s bug-free and runs smoothly. You’ll need to test your game on different devices, browsers, and operating systems to ensure that it works well in all environments. You can use testing frameworks like Jest or Enzyme to write tests for your game’s components and functionality.

Skills Required for Building a Gaming App

Building a gaming app requires a range of skills, and a front-end developer should have the following:

  1. Strong knowledge of JavaScript, HTML, and CSS.
  2. Experience with React and Redux.
  3. Familiarity with animation libraries, such as GreenSock or Framer Motion.
  4. Knowledge of game development concepts, such as game mechanics, game loops, and physics engines.
  5. Familiarity with testing frameworks, such as Jest or Enzyme.
  6. Understanding of responsive design principles and how to design for different device sizes and resolutions.
  7. Knowledge of UI/UX design principles and best practices.
  8. Ability to collaborate with other team members, such as game designers, back-end developers, and QA testers.
  9. Ability to write clean, maintainable, and scalable code.
  10. Strong problem-solving and critical-thinking skills to identify and resolve issues that arise during the development process.
